The prompt "USB device is not recognized" in Windows 10 is usually due to driver problems, hardware failures, or abnormal system settings. When encountering this situation, don’t rush to change cables or computers, in fact, you can solve it yourself most of the time.

Check whether the USB device and interface are normal
This problem is not necessarily a system problem, but may also be a problem with the hardware itself.

- Try to replace the USB port : Some USB ports are unstable or damaged in power supply, try changing the interface.
- Replacement data cable or device test : Sometimes the cable is broken or there is a problem with the device itself, such as the USB drive or mobile hard drive failure, which may also lead to identification failure.
- Check whether the device is powered normally : Some high-power devices (such as mobile hard drives) may require external power, otherwise they will not work properly.
Restart USB related services
Windows has many backend services that support hardware recognition. Sometimes these services are stuck and will cause USB device recognition to fail.
You can do this:

- Press
Win R
to open the run window and enterservices.msc
to enter. - Find the following two services and right-click to select "Restart":
- USB Arbitrator Service
- Device Management Wireless LAN service (although the name is a bit strange, it can sometimes affect recognition)
If you cannot find these services, you can also try restarting the entire system to see if there is any improvement.
Update or reinstall the USB driver
Drive problems are a common cause of this prompt. You can manually update the USB controller driver:
- Press
Win X
and select Device Manager. - Expand Universal Serial Bus Controller.
- Right-click on each device with the word "USB" and select "Update Driver" or "Uninstall Device".
- Then unplug and re-insert the USB device, and the system will automatically reinstall the driver.
If you are not sure which drivers should be moved, you can right-click on "Universal Serial Bus Controller" and select "Scan to detect hardware changes".
Adjust power management settings
Sometimes in order to save power, the system will turn off the power supply of the USB interface, which will also lead to identification failure.
The operation method is as follows:
- In Device Manager, go to "Universal Serial Bus Controller" again.
- Find "USB Root Hub" or a project with similar name, right-click and select "Properties".
- Switch to the Power Management tab and uncheck "Allow computer to turn off this device to save power."
This setting is more practical for users who frequently plug and unplug the device, and it is recommended to keep it off.
Basically these common ways of dealing with it. In most cases, you can solve the problem by trying it in sequence. If it still doesn't work, it may be a problem with the device itself.
